The single biggest advantage browser games hold is the elimination of every barrier between a player and gameplay. No app store approval processes. No storage space calculations. No update downloads. No account creation walls. You see a game, you click it, you're playing. This "zero friction" model sounds obvious, but its impact is profound: it means that the decision to play a game and actually playing it happen in the same moment, with no opportunity for second-guessing or distraction.
Compare this to the mobile experience: search the store, read reviews, check permissions, wait for download, open the app, sit through a tutorial video, create an account, accept terms. By the time you're actually playing, the initial impulse has faded. Browser games capture motivation at its peak, and that changes everything about how we discover and commit to new gaming experiences.
Browser games used to mean Flash animations and simple mechanics. The transition to HTML5 Canvas and WebGL changed the technical ceiling, but the real revolution happened gradually as browser engines optimized for gaming workloads. Today's browser games leverage technologies that would have been impossible five years ago:
The widespread adoption of WebGPU gives browser games near-native graphics performance. 3D games that once required plugins now render at 60fps with advanced lighting, particle effects, and post-processing. The visual gap between browser and native games has narrowed to the point where most players can't tell the difference in side-by-side comparisons.
WebAssembly allows developers to compile existing game engines (Unity, Godot) directly to browser-compatible code. A growing number of popular browser games are actually full engine titles running in a tab, with no compromises in game logic or physics simulation. This means browser games can offer the same depth as their downloadable counterparts.
Modern browser games can install as PWAs, offer offline play through service workers, send notifications for time-sensitive game events, and even access device sensors. The line between "browser game" and "app" has blurred to the point where the distinction is mostly philosophical.
Multi-threaded JavaScript enables complex AI, physics simulations, and pathfinding algorithms that were previously exclusive to native applications. Tower defense games with hundreds of units, racing games with realistic vehicle physics, and strategy games with sophisticated opponent AI all run smoothly in modern browsers.
Perhaps the most significant driver of browser gaming's growth is cultural. In 2026, people are tired of games that demand their lives. Battle passes with daily login requirements, seasons that reset monthly, live-service games that punish absence - these models create obligation rather than enjoyment. Browser games represent the opposite philosophy: play when you want, for as long as you want, with no consequences for leaving.
This shift toward "intentional leisure" is particularly strong among adults aged 25-45, who represent the fastest-growing browser gaming demographic. They don't have time for 40-hour RPGs or maintaining a competitive rank in an online shooter. They want a satisfying gaming experience that fits into the margins of their day - a puzzle during lunch, a racing game while waiting for a meeting, a tower defense session on a Sunday morning.
The browser games market has become economically attractive for reasons that go beyond development cost. Without app store commissions (typically 30%), browser game developers keep significantly more revenue per player. The distribution model is also simpler: a URL is all you need to share a game. No screenshots, no descriptions, no keyword optimization - just a link that leads directly to gameplay.
Indie developers in particular have found browser gaming to be a creative haven. Without the pressure to maximize retention metrics or monetize every interaction, browser games can prioritize fun over engagement optimization. This creative freedom produces the kind of innovative, experimental titles that are increasingly rare in the app store ecosystem, where risk-averse publishers dominate the charts.
Mobile browsers have closed the performance gap with desktop to a remarkable degree. Modern mobile Chrome and Safari handle WebGL content with hardware acceleration, touch controls are natively supported, and the full-screen API provides an immersive experience indistinguishable from a native app. For casual and mid-core games, the mobile browser is now a legitimate gaming platform that doesn't require users to sacrifice storage space for games they might play once a week.
This is particularly relevant in emerging markets where phone storage is limited and data plans are metered. Downloading a 200MB game app is a meaningful commitment; loading a browser game that streams assets as needed is essentially free. Browser gaming's accessibility isn't just about convenience - in many regions, it's about fundamental access to gaming as a form of entertainment.
